Comic Josie Lawrence is to leave 'EastEnders' next year.

Digital Spy, which broke the story, says that Lawrence, who plays Manda Best, will leave the show after discovering that boyfriend Minty Peterson (Cliff Parisi) is hiding a "huge secret".
Lawrence told Digital Spy: "It has been an amazing year at 'EastEnders' and I have made some fantastic friends among both the cast and crew.
"I am somebody who likes to do a variety of different projects, and now seems the right time to move on."
An unnamed source said of Manda and Minty: "Their relationship takes a turn for the worst when Manda discovers that Minty's been hiding something from her. The revelation then serves as the catalyst for Manda's exit."
But Lawrence's on-screen son Adam (David Proud) will be staying in Albert Square.
The source said: "Even though Manda's leaving, Adam's sticking around in Walford. There's lots to come for him as the love triangle between Adam, Libby (Belinda Owusu) and Darren (Charlie G Hawkins) rumbles on."
